What are the benefits of using a local home builder in Limestone County?

Choosing a local Limestone County home builder offers several key advantages. They possess intimate knowledge of local regulations, building codes, and the unique characteristics of the land. This understanding translates to smoother permitting processes, cost-effective construction, and a deeper awareness of local materials and suppliers. Furthermore, local builders often have established relationships with subcontractors and suppliers, potentially leading to better pricing and faster project timelines. Finally, supporting local businesses contributes directly to the community's economic well-being.

How do I find reputable home builders in Limestone County?

Finding a reputable builder starts with thorough research. Begin by searching online directories, checking local listings, and asking for referrals from friends, family, and colleagues who have recently built homes in the area. Look for builders with strong online presence, positive customer reviews, and a portfolio showcasing their previous projects. Investigate their licensing and insurance coverage—crucial for protecting your investment. Don't hesitate to visit completed homes to assess their quality and craftsmanship firsthand. This personal inspection can reveal details not always apparent in photos or online descriptions.

What questions should I ask potential home builders?

Asking the right questions is vital. Inquire about their experience, licensing, insurance, and warranty offerings. Understand their communication style and project management approach. Request detailed cost breakdowns, including contingency plans for potential unforeseen expenses. Clarify their subcontractor selection process and how they handle disputes or delays. It's also important to discuss their design capabilities and willingness to incorporate your personal preferences. Finally, request references and contact previous clients to gather firsthand testimonials about their experiences.

What are the common challenges faced when building a home in Limestone County?

Building a home, anywhere, presents challenges. In Limestone County, factors like weather conditions, access to specific materials, and navigating local building codes may add to the complexity. Thorough planning, clear communication with your builder, and a realistic understanding of potential delays are crucial. Engaging a reputable builder with experience in the region minimizes many potential obstacles. Open communication throughout the construction process is key to successfully navigating any unforeseen difficulties.
